How Can Dementia Along With Hallucinations And Panic Attacks Be Treated?

My 87 year old mother-in-law has dementia and has started having hallucinations that are getting more upsetting. We are planning to move her to memory care unit from independent living. She has been to her primary care and we are waiting for Feb. 5 geriatric psych appointment. She appears to have anxiety attack now because she can t do what the people she sees want her to do. Suggestions on how to help until Feb. 5. Her primary was reluctant to prescribe anxiety med until psych visit.

dear caregiver
dementia with hallucinations can be underlying organic etiology
And dementia can be comorbid with anxiety and depressive disorders
careful interview by psychiatrist is needed. Successful treatment of behavioural issues with dementia by medications is available
